Memory Capacity Planning in Advanced Computer Architecture in Hindi - विस्तृत जानकारी


Memory Capacity Planning क्या है?

Memory Capacity Planning कंप्यूटर सिस्टम में मेमोरी संसाधनों के इष्टतम उपयोग और भविष्य की आवश्यकताओं के अनुसार योजना बनाने की प्रक्रिया है। यह उन्नत कंप्यूटर आर्किटेक्चर में सिस्टम प्रदर्शन को बेहतर बनाने और लागत को कम करने के लिए एक महत्वपूर्ण चरण है।

Memory Capacity Planning के उद्देश्य

  • प्रोसेसर और मेमोरी के बीच समन्वय बनाए रखना
  • डेटा प्रोसेसिंग की गति को बढ़ाना
  • मेमोरी की लागत और ऊर्जा खपत को नियंत्रित करना
  • अत्यधिक मेमोरी उपयोग या अपर्याप्त संसाधनों की समस्या से बचाव

Memory Capacity Planning के घटक

Memory Capacity Planning को प्रभावी रूप से लागू करने के लिए निम्नलिखित घटक आवश्यक होते हैं:

1. Workload Analysis (कार्यभार विश्लेषण)

  • सिस्टम द्वारा उपयोग किए जाने वाले डेटा की मात्रा का विश्लेषण
  • एप्लिकेशन की मेमोरी आवश्यकताओं की समीक्षा
  • CPU और I/O प्रक्रियाओं का मूल्यांकन

2. Performance Metrics (प्रदर्शन मेट्रिक्स)

  • Memory Latency (मेमोरी विलंबता)
  • Bandwidth (बैंडविड्थ)
  • Cache Hit Ratio (कैश हिट अनुपात)
  • Paging और Swapping की आवृत्ति

3. Scalability Planning (विस्तार क्षमता योजना)

  • भविष्य की जरूरतों के अनुसार मेमोरी अपग्रेड की योजना बनाना
  • क्लाउड-आधारित स्टोरेज और वर्चुअल मेमोरी का उपयोग
  • Big Data और AI वर्कलोड के लिए मेमोरी ऑप्टिमाइज़ेशन

Memory Capacity Planning के चरण

  1. वर्तमान सिस्टम विश्लेषण: मौजूदा सिस्टम की मेमोरी संरचना, स्टोरेज उपयोग और प्रदर्शन मेट्रिक्स का अध्ययन।
  2. भविष्य की आवश्यकताओं का अनुमान: भविष्य की एप्लिकेशन और डेटा वृद्धि को ध्यान में रखते हुए मेमोरी योजना तैयार करना।
  3. हार्डवेयर चयन: उपयुक्त RAM, Cache, SSD और Cloud Storage का चयन।
  4. मॉनिटरिंग और ऑप्टिमाइज़ेशन: नियमित रूप से मेमोरी प्रदर्शन की निगरानी करना और आवश्यकतानुसार संसाधनों को अपग्रेड करना।

Memory Capacity Planning में उपयोग होने वाली तकनीकें

तकनीक विवरण
Virtual Memory RAM की सीमित क्षमता को बढ़ाने के लिए हार्ड डिस्क का उपयोग करता है।
Memory Caching प्रायः उपयोग किए जाने वाले डेटा को तेज एक्सेस के लिए Cache Memory में स्टोर करता है।
Memory Tiering अलग-अलग स्पीड और स्टोरेज क्षमता वाली मेमोरी को लेयर में व्यवस्थित करता है।
Dynamic RAM Allocation सिस्टम लोड के अनुसार मेमोरी आवंटन को स्वचालित रूप से समायोजित करता है।

Memory Capacity Planning के लाभ

  • बेहतर सिस्टम प्रदर्शन
  • डाटा प्रोसेसिंग की दक्षता में वृद्धि
  • ऊर्जा और लागत की बचत
  • सिस्टम स्केलेबिलिटी में सुधार
  • हार्डवेयर अपग्रेड की योजना को सुव्यवस्थित बनाना

निष्कर्ष

Memory Capacity Planning एक महत्वपूर्ण प्रक्रिया है जो कंप्यूटर आर्किटेक्चर में सिस्टम दक्षता, प्रदर्शन और लागत को प्रभावी ढंग से संतुलित करने में सहायता करती है। यह आधुनिक कंप्यूटिंग सिस्टम, क्लाउड कंप्यूटिंग, बिग डेटा और AI-आधारित वर्कलोड के लिए आवश्यक होता है।

Related Post

Comments

Comments